Purified Terephthalic Acid (PTA) (cas no 100 21 0) is an important organic compound, which is in the form of a white powder with a molecular formula of C6H4(CO2H)2. Its self ignition point is 680 ℃ and the ignition point is 384-421 ℃. It has low toxicity and has a certain irritant effect on the skin and mucous membranes. Pure terephthalic acid can dissolve in hot ethanol and alkaline solutions. PTA pure terephthalic acid is obtained through petroleum processing, extraction, and reaction, mainly used to produce polyester, which is a key raw material for the production of chemical fiber products, including polyester fibers (polyester), polyester films, and polyester bottle sheets. What Are the Primary Applications of Purified Terephthalic Acid?

1. Purified Terephthalic Acid is mainly used in the production of polyester, such as polyester fibers (polyester), polyester films, and polyester bottle chips, among other chemical fiber products.
2. Purified Terephthalic Acid can also be used as a key raw material for other important chemical products.
